BBO crystals are developed using the flux strategy, a process that consists of melting raw products at significant temperatures. The molten material is then bit by bit cooled to sort a crystal. This process requires specific control of temperature and cooling rate to make sure the crystal’s high-quality and integrity.

The Uncooked products, normally a combination of barium carbonate and boric acid, are positioned inside of a platinum crucible and heated until finally they soften. The temperature is then step by step lowered, enabling the BBO crystal to type over many weeks. The crystal is then extracted, Minimize into the specified form, and polished to achieve a large-good quality optical floor.
